The Complete Guide to Exercising Away Stress contains all the information necessary for personal trainers and sports coaches to be able to advise clients correctly and responsibly on how to combat stress through exercise.
Stress is a growing concern in today's world and has been linked to a wide range of health problems, from irritable bowel syndrome to depression. Exercise, activity and nutrition are key tools for dealing with pressure, so personal trainers and sports coaches are ideally placed to help their clients manage stress.
This book covers the causes of and responses to stress; how to recognise the signs and symptoms of stress; practical physical and mental strategies and techniques for managing stress; and how to develop the skills and qualities needed to deal effectively with clients.
Debbie Lawrence is a consultant and writer for the health and fitness industry and has over 30 years' experience as a fitness professional and educator. She is a qualified integrative counselor, a student of yoga and has a special interest in mental health and well-being. She has written a number of qualification and training resources for some of the leading awarding and training organisations in the sector, including: CYQ, The Open University, Active IQ, Yfit, VTCT and EDI.
